National Crayola Day, celebrated on April 25, is a fun day to appreciate Crayola crayons and creativity. It's a time when kids and adults can enjoy drawing and coloring together. People use Crayola crayons to make colorful pictures and express their imagination. It's a special day to remember how crayons bring joy and help us share our ideas through art. On this day, schools and families might have coloring contests or art projects to celebrate and encourage creativity.
How to celebrate National Crayola Day?
Grab your favorite Crayola crayons and invite your friends for a fun coloring party! Set up a table with coloring books, blank paper, and lots of crayons. You can draw animals, rainbows, or create your own superhero. Make it more fun by having a coloring contest with small prizes like stickers or snacks. Don't forget to bring some yummy snacks and drinks to enjoy. If it's a sunny day, take your drawing fun outside in the fresh air. At the end, hang up your artwork to make a colorful display. Share your creations with friends and family for smiles everywhere!
